"I've Lived This Way, So Alone" is another classic poetry collection by Nobel laureate Wisława Szymborska, following "Things Are Quiet Like a Mystery," now available in a new hardcover commemorative edition.
In this collection, the poet uses a witty, charming voice and tone to express her nostalgia for and praise of family, her love for life's myriad aspects, her fascination with vanished time and nations, and her poetic depictions of everyday life and all things. This subtly reflects the poet's rich inner world and her solitary life.
The book includes over 80 poems, such as "A Farewell to a Landscape," "The Version of Events," "No Gift," "I'm Trying to Create a World," "In Heraclitus's River," and "Children of the Age." It also features re-translations of over 10 widely acclaimed works from "Things Are Quiet Like a Mystery," including "Love at First Sight," "Possibilities," and "Under One Small Star," allowing readers to glimpse the timeless charm of these classics through different interpretations.
